summaryrefslogtreecommitdiff
path: root/deployment/systems/aisaka.scm
diff options
context:
space:
mode:
Diffstat (limited to 'deployment/systems/aisaka.scm')
-rw-r--r--deployment/systems/aisaka.scm15
1 files changed, 11 insertions, 4 deletions
diff --git a/deployment/systems/aisaka.scm b/deployment/systems/aisaka.scm
index 83bc320..c4c01ca 100644
--- a/deployment/systems/aisaka.scm
+++ b/deployment/systems/aisaka.scm
@@ -51,16 +51,18 @@
#:prefix gnu:system:linux-initrd:)
#:use-module ((gnu system locale)
#:prefix gnu:system:locale:)
+ #:use-module ((gnu packages matrix)
+ #:prefix gnu:packages:matrix:)
#:use-module ((gnu system nss)
#:prefix gnu:system:nss:)
#:use-module ((gnu system pam)
#:prefix gnu:system:pam:)
#:use-module ((gnu system shadow)
#:prefix gnu:system:shadow:)
+ #:use-module ((guix diagnostics)
+ #:prefix guix:diagnostics:)
#:use-module ((nongnu packages linux)
#:prefix nongnu:packages:linux:)
- #:use-module ((gnu packages matrix)
- #:prefix gnu:packages:matrix:)
#:use-module ((nongnu system linux-initrd)
#:prefix nongnu:system:linux-initrd:)
#:use-module ((sovereign devices)
@@ -76,7 +78,7 @@
#:use-module ((users vmail)
#:prefix users:vmail:))
-(define system-name "aisaka")
+(define-public system-name "aisaka")
(define ip-multimedia "81.190.248.246")
@@ -697,6 +699,9 @@
(define guix-home-service
(sovereign:systems:guix-home-service named-home-environments))
+(define-public architecture
+ "x86_64-linux")
+
(define-public system
(gnu:system:operating-system
(kernel nongnu:packages:linux:linux)
@@ -756,6 +761,8 @@
(privileged-programs gnu:system:%default-privileged-programs)
(setuid-programs gnu:system:%setuid-programs)
(sudoers-file sovereign:systems:%sovereign-sudoers-specification)
- (location gnu:system:operating-system-location)))
+ (location (and=> (current-source-location)
+ guix:diagnostics:source-properties->location))))
+
(define-public operating-system* system)